Episode Overview

Andrew Santino joins Joe Rogan for a wide-ranging conversation that blends sharp comedy with candid reflections on life and culture. They kick off by discussing the challenges of urban living, touching on gentrification in East LA and the absurdity of skyrocketing real estate prices, with Santino sharing vivid stories about neighborhoods like Boyle Heights and the clash between longtime residents and incoming hipsters. The conversation then shifts to outdoor survival and wildlife, inspired by Santino’s fascination with wilderness living. He recounts tales of living simply in small spaces, training dogs, and encounters with predators like wolves and bears, illustrating the raw realities of nature and mortality. Health and wellness also feature prominently, as Santino talks about his experiences with cryotherapy and the Wim Hof breathing method, highlighting the mental and physical benefits of these practices. The duo dive into the evolving landscape of comedy, reflecting on the grind of club performances, the impact of social media on the craft, and the importance of authentic connection with audiences. Throughout, Santino’s humor and storytelling shine, offering a mix of personal anecdotes, cultural observations, and sharp insights into the worlds of entertainment, nature, and human behavior.

About Andrew Santino

Andrew Santino is a talented stand-up comedian and actor known for his sharp wit and charismatic stage presence. With a successful comedy special, "Home Field Advantage," premiering on Showtime in June 2023, he showcases his unique perspective and humor. Santino is also recognized for his role in the critically acclaimed series "I'm Dying Up Here," which delves into the world of stand-up comedy in the 1970s. Beyond his performances, he is celebrated for his engaging podcast, "Whiskey Ginger," where he shares insights and stories with fellow comedians and entertainers. With a knack for blending personal anecdotes with observational humor, Santino captivates audiences and continues to make a significant mark in the comedy scene.
